在人工智能和机器学习领域,监督学习方法一直是研究和应用的热点。全方位监督方法作为一种新兴的监督学习方法,旨在通过结合多种技术手段,提高模型的泛化能力和鲁棒性。本文将深入解析全方位监督方法的原理、实践及其在各个领域的应用。
全方位监督方法概述
全方位监督方法(All-in-One Supervision)是一种结合了多种监督学习技术的集成方法。它通过以下三个方面实现:
- 数据增强:通过数据预处理、数据变换等手段,增加数据集的多样性,提高模型的泛化能力。
- 多任务学习:同时训练多个相关任务,使模型在处理单一任务时能够利用其他任务的信息,提高模型的表达能力。
- 元学习:通过学习如何学习,使模型能够快速适应新任务,提高模型的迁移能力。
数据增强
数据增强是全方位监督方法的核心之一。以下是一些常见的数据增强技术:
1. 预处理
- 归一化:将数据缩放到一个特定的范围,如[0,1]或[-1,1]。
- 标准化:将数据转换为均值为0,标准差为1的分布。
- 裁剪:从图像中裁剪出特定大小的区域。
2. 数据变换
- 旋转:将图像旋转一定角度。
- 缩放:改变图像的大小。
- 翻转:水平或垂直翻转图像。
多任务学习
多任务学习(Multi-Task Learning,MTL)是指同时训练多个相关任务,使模型能够共享特征表示。以下是一些多任务学习的应用场景:
1. 图像分类与检测
- 目标检测:同时检测图像中的多个目标。
- 姿态估计:估计图像中人物的姿态。
2. 自然语言处理
- 文本分类:对文本进行分类。
- 情感分析:分析文本的情感倾向。
元学习
元学习(Meta-Learning)是一种通过学习如何学习来提高模型适应新任务的方法。以下是一些元学习的应用场景:
1. 快速适应新任务
- 迁移学习:将已学到的知识迁移到新任务。
- 多任务学习:通过同时训练多个任务,提高模型对新任务的适应能力。
2. 减少数据需求
- 自监督学习:通过无监督学习技术,减少对标注数据的依赖。
全方位监督方法的应用
全方位监督方法在各个领域都有广泛的应用,以下是一些典型应用:
1. 计算机视觉
- 图像分类:提高图像分类的准确率。
- 目标检测:提高目标检测的精度和速度。
2. 自然语言处理
- 文本分类:提高文本分类的准确率。
- 机器翻译:提高机器翻译的质量。
3. 语音识别
- 语音分类:提高语音分类的准确率。
- 语音合成:提高语音合成的自然度。
总结
全方位监督方法作为一种新兴的监督学习方法,在提高模型的泛化能力和鲁棒性方面具有显著优势。随着研究的不断深入,全方位监督方法将在更多领域得到应用,为人工智能的发展贡献力量。
